~ubuntu-branches/ubuntu/hoary/debian-edu/hoary

« back to all changes in this revision

Viewing changes to tasks/main-server

  • Committer: Bazaar Package Importer
  • Author(s): Joey Hess
  • Date: 2004-06-10 13:18:54 UTC
  • Revision ID: james.westby@ubuntu.com-20040610131854-fhtqpfxy2ewofoew
Tags: 0.771
* Joey Hess
  - Rebuild against current testing, amaya-gtk and amaya-lesstif are no
    longer available.
  - Medium urgency upload to perhaps get into testing this time.

Show diffs side-by-side

added added

removed removed

Lines of Context:
 
1
Architecture: all
 
2
Description: DebianEdu Main Server packages.
 
3
 A metapackage containing dependencies for packages required on all
 
4
 main server installations in the DebianEdu custom Debian distribution.
 
5
 
 
6
Depends:     education-networked
 
7
Why:         Packages which should be present on all networked
 
8
             skolelinux machines
 
9
Responsible: Petter Reinholdtsen
 
10
NeedConfig:  no
 
11
 
 
12
Ignore:      iptables, shorewall, iproute
 
13
Why:         Needed to set up firewalling rules using netfilter in 2.4.x
 
14
Responsible: Lars Bahner
 
15
NeedConfig:  yes - set up default firewall rules
 
16
 
 
17
Depends:     bind9, bind9-doc, nslint, zone-file-check, dnswalk, dlint
 
18
Why:         DNS server for the local clients.   Should we use bind 8 or 9?
 
19
Responsible: Rune Nordb�e Skillingstad
 
20
NeedConfig:  yes - set a few well known DNS names, and more.
 
21
 
 
22
Depends:     dhcp3-server
 
23
Why:         Automatic distribution of IP addresses to the clients
 
24
Responsible: Christian Juell
 
25
NeedConfig:  yes - set local IP range, DNS name and default routing
 
26
 
 
27
Depends:     slapd, webmin-ldap-skolelinux | webmin-ldap-user-simple, openssl
 
28
Why:         Allow LDAP user authentication and centralized administration.
 
29
Responsible: Rune Nordb�e Skillingstad
 
30
NeedConfig:  yes - generate certificates for ssl/tls support
 
31
 
 
32
Depends:     webmin-ldap-netgroups
 
33
Why:         Allow LDAP host netgroup updating.
 
34
Responsible: Alex Brasetvik
 
35
NeedConfig:  no
 
36
 
 
37
Depends:     courier-imap-ssl, courier-ldap
 
38
Why:         The users use imap to get mail from the "postoffice"
 
39
Responsible: Andreas Dahl
 
40
NeedConfig:  yes
 
41
 
 
42
Depends:     lynx-ssl
 
43
Why:         To be able to access webmin without a gui
 
44
Responsible: Andreas Dahl
 
45
NeedConfig:  ?
 
46
 
 
47
Depends:     nfs-kernel-server, samba, samba-doc, makepasswd, tdb-tools
 
48
Why:         Make home directory available on each client using NFS, SMB
 
49
             and Appletalk
 
50
Responsible: ?
 
51
NeedConfig:  yes - specify which directories to distribute
 
52
 
 
53
Depends:     apache, apache-doc, webalizer
 
54
Why:         Internal webserver
 
55
Responsible: ?
 
56
NeedConfig:  ?
 
57
 
 
58
Depends:     squid, calamaris, squidguard, chastity-list
 
59
Why:         Speed up web browsing and reduce network load.
 
60
Responsible: Roy-Magne Mo (Need to check if the list of packages is sensible)
 
61
NeedConfig:  ?
 
62
 
 
63
Depends:     dsh
 
64
Why:         Distributed shell.  Make it easier to administrate many
 
65
             machines.
 
66
Responsible: Petter Reinholdtsen
 
67
NeedConfig:  maybe - configure host groups
 
68
 
 
69
Depends:     ntp-refclock
 
70
Why:         Make sure the server supports a local clock.  The configuration
 
71
             is done using cfengine.
 
72
Responsible: Petter Reinholdtsen
 
73
NeedConfig:  yes - set NTP server (client: ntp.intern, server: ntp.somewhere)
 
74
 
 
75
Depends:     webmin, webmin-core, webmin-apache, webmin-bind, \
 
76
             webmin-dhcpd, webmin-exports, \
 
77
             webmin-inetd, webmin-lvm, webmin-quota, webmin-raid, \
 
78
             webmin-samba, webmin-software, webmin-squid, webmin-status, \
 
79
             webmin-cfengine, webmin-webalizer, \
 
80
             webmin-sshd, webmin-cupsadmin-skolelinux
 
81
Recommends:  webmin-grub
 
82
Why:         Allow for web based administration of the server.  [I'm not sure
 
83
             if we should be using this, but I'm adding it to the CD as a test.
 
84
             pere 2001-12-07]
 
85
Responsible: ?
 
86
NeedConfig:  ?
 
87
 
 
88
Depends:     slbackup, webmin-slbackup, ssh
 
89
Why:         The backup system
 
90
Responsible: Morten Werner Olsen
 
91
NeedConfig:  yes - debconf (only the slbackup package)
 
92
 
 
93
Avoid:       telnetd, ftpd, 
 
94
Why:         The servers we want to exclude.  All really insecure services
 
95
             should be listed.
 
96
Responsible: Petter Reinholdtsen
 
97
NeedConfig:  no
 
98
 
 
99
Depends:     lrrd-server | munin
 
100
Why:         Needed to see what happens
 
101
Responsible: Finn-Arne Johansen
 
102
NeedConfig:  Yes, we need to set what machines we want to graph
 
103
 
 
104
Depends:     ncs
 
105
Why:         Needed to see when things go wrong
 
106
Responsible: Ragnar Wisloff
 
107
NeedConfig:  Should not need that, no